C# を使用して透明画像を作成する

この記事では、C# を使用して透明なPNGを作成する方法を説明します。IDE の設定方法、手順、そして透明画像ジェネレーターを C# で作成するサンプルコードが含まれています。ゼロから透明画像を作成し、指定した色を透明にする方法を学びます。

C# で透明 PNG を作成する手順

  1. Aspose.Imaging for .NET を使用するための環境を設定する
  2. 画像サイズを定義し、アルファ透明度を持つ PngOptions オブジェクトを作成する
  3. 定義したオプションとサイズで画像を作成する
  4. 読み込んだ画像のピクセルコレクションにアクセスし、白い背景を透明にする
  5. 変更したピクセルを空の画像に保存する
  6. 画像用の Graphics オブジェクトを作成し、さまざまな図形やテキストを描画する
  7. 透明な背景と描画内容で画像を保存する

これらの手順は、C# の透明写真ジェネレーターの開発プロセスをまとめたものです。最終的な画像サイズを定義し、アルファチャネル付きの PngOptions を作成し、空の画像を作成して RasterImage に変換し、ピクセルを操作して白背景を透明にし、必要に応じて図形や文字を描画して保存します。

透明画像ジェネレーターの C# コード

このコードは、C# で透明画像を作成する方法を示しています。半透明の画像を作成するには、0~255 の値を設定します(0 = 完全に透明、255 = 不透明)。他の色を透明にするには、Color.FromArgb() メソッドで目的の RGB 値を指定します。

この記事では、透明画像クリエーターの作成方法を紹介しました。写真に署名を追加するには、C# で写真に署名を追加の記事を参照してください。

 日本語